Introduction

Durga Pooja, also known as Durgotsav, is a significant festival in Hinduism, celebrated to honor Goddess Durga, the goddess of strength, courage, and wisdom. The festival is observed for nine days, with each day dedicated to a different form of the goddess. The Durga Pooja Vidhi is a set of rituals and practices that are followed during this festival to worship and seek the blessings of Goddess Durga. In this article, we will delve into the significance, preparation, and step-by-step guide to performing the Durga Pooja Vidhi. The Durga Pooja Vidhi is an intricate ritual that requires careful preparation and attention to detail. It is essential to understand the significance and importance of each step to ensure a successful and meaningful worship experience. The ritual is typically performed during the autumn season, and its significance is deeply rooted in Hindu mythology and scripture.

Significance

The Durga Pooja Vidhi is significant because it allows devotees to connect with Goddess Durga and seek her blessings for strength, courage, and wisdom. The ritual is also a celebration of the triumph of good over evil, as embodied in the mythological story of Goddess Durga's victory over the buffalo-demon Mahishasura. The Durga Pooja Vidhi is a powerful way to invoke the divine feminine energy and to seek protection, guidance, and spiritual growth.

Best Time to Perform

The best time to perform the Durga Pooja Vidhi is during the Navaratri festival, which typically falls in September or October. The ritual can be performed at any time of the day, but it is recommended to perform it during the morning or evening hours when the energy is most conducive for worship.

Required Samagri (Materials)

Durga idol or picture
Incense sticks
Candles
Flowers
Fruits
Sweets
Coconuts
Kumkum
Haldi
Rice
Water

Preparation Steps

  1. 1Clean and decorate the worship area
  2. 2Install the Durga idol or picture
  3. 3Prepare the necessary samagri
  4. 4Take a bath and wear clean clothes
  5. 5Perform a preliminary puja to purify the mind and body

Step-by-Step Vidhi

  1. 1Invoke Goddess Durga by chanting the Durga Mantra
  2. 2Offer flowers, fruits, and sweets to the goddess
  3. 3Light incense sticks and candles
  4. 4Perform aarti and sing devotional songs
  5. 5Offer coconut and kumkum to the goddess
  6. 6Chant the Durga Chalisa and other devotional hymns
  7. 7Seek the blessings of Goddess Durga for strength, courage, and wisdom

Regional Variations

  • The Durga Pooja Vidhi is celebrated differently in different regions of India
  • The festival is known as Durgotsav in Bengal, Navaratri in Gujarat, and Dussehra in other parts of India
  • The rituals and customs of the festival vary according to the regional traditions and practices
